|
|
@@ -56,6 +56,7 @@ import com.uas.appworks.OA.erp.activity.form.DataFormFieldActivity;
|
|
|
import com.uas.appworks.OA.erp.activity.form.FormListSelectActivity;
|
|
|
import com.uas.appworks.OA.erp.model.form.GroupData;
|
|
|
import com.uas.appworks.R;
|
|
|
+import com.uas.appworks.activity.DeviceQueryActivity;
|
|
|
|
|
|
import java.text.DecimalFormat;
|
|
|
import java.text.ParseException;
|
|
|
@@ -658,7 +659,18 @@ public class DeviceDataFormAddActivity extends BaseActivity implements View.OnCl
|
|
|
@Override
|
|
|
public boolean onOptionsItemSelected(MenuItem item) {
|
|
|
if (item.getItemId() == R.id.oa_leave) {
|
|
|
-//TODO 进入设备查询 startActivity(new Intent(ct,));
|
|
|
+ String dc_class = null;
|
|
|
+ if (caller.equals("DeviceChange!Use")) {
|
|
|
+ dc_class = "使用转移";
|
|
|
+ } else if (caller.equals("DeviceChange!Scrap")) {
|
|
|
+ dc_class = "报废";
|
|
|
+ } else if (caller.equals("DeviceBatch!Maintain")) {
|
|
|
+ dc_class = "保养维护";
|
|
|
+ } else if (caller.equals("DeviceChange!Inspect")) {
|
|
|
+ dc_class = "故障送检";
|
|
|
+ }
|
|
|
+ startActivity(new Intent(ct, DeviceQueryActivity.class).putExtra(Constants.FLAG.DEVICE_CALLER, caller)
|
|
|
+ .putExtra(Constants.FLAG.DEVICE_CLASS, dc_class));
|
|
|
}
|
|
|
return super.onOptionsItemSelected(item);
|
|
|
}
|